  2. ← I can give you an answer on your question. My name is Scott Barton, and I am Rick and Gale's partner @ Tru. The caviar staircase that had previously been offered as a first course with most of our collections consisted of an assortment of one sturgeon caviar, and three different fish roes(salmon, trout, smoked whitefish, wasabi tobiko, etc.). We do not use that as a starter course for our collections currently, but if you are interested in starting with that, we will gladly do it for you. Based on the sturgeon caviar that you choose, there may be an additional charge. You may ask your server when you arrive, or let us know when making a reservation. Currently as a first course, we offer a selection of Japanese sashimi-grade fish with complementary garnishes. The caviar staircase that is on our menu right now is a tasting of different Iranian and sustainable sturgeon caviars. It is a much different tasting than the staircase previously offered on our collections.
